Warsaw, having been destroyed totally twice in it's 700 year long history, is today a jigsaw puzzle, combining different shapes and styles. On this tour we will show you many diverse pieces of this puzzle and teach you how to put them together.

AREA COVERED: southern part of historical centre + the communist area.

1st half of the tour covers the Royal Route, which is the most elegant Warsaw street. Here in the 17th and 18th century wealthy noblemen were building their luxurious residences, powerful religious orders were erecting their baroque churches, here in the 19th century Chopin lived and Marie Curie was studying, here the most important events in Polish post-war history were taking place.

In the 2nd half of the tour you will explore the 20th-century city centre with the most iconic Warsaw building: the Palace of Culture, the famous gift from Stalin to the People’s Republic of Poland, aimed to reshape Warsaw’s historical city centre and give Warsaw a new communist identity.
